Ibra Sekajja grabbed the winner as a young Crystal Palace team ended their pre-season campaign with a 2-1 win at Bromley.
Dougie Freedman started with ex-Hull City forward Craig Fagan and youngster Charlie Kasler, while trialist Antonio Pedroza was on the bench.
Bromley got the scoring underway in the 11th minute when former Palace striker Gareth Williams set up midfielder Aaron Rhule to fire past Lewis Price.
Palace were on level terms five minutes later after Calvin Andrew's shot was blocked by home defender Joe Dolan and diverted into his own net.
Fagan won a penalty for the Eagles after he was knocked over the box but Dean Santangelo saved the resulting spot-kick.
Bromley's Nathan Green hit the bar with a header but the Eagles added a second thanks to subs Jon Williams and Sekajja combining for the latter to score.
Palace: Price, Caprice, Holness, Taylor, Daniel (Jerome Williams 71), Cadogan (Pedroza 71), Kasler (Sow 63), Dorman, Andrew (Jon Williams 55), Fagan, Pinney (Sekajja 55).
Not used: Fitzsimons, Dymond, De Silva.
